Hi Guys

Please help me. I am trying to install a emulex lpe1150-e fiber card on freenas.
Does it list under network interfaces if it detect it?

Go into the command line and type ifconfig and see what shows up.


You will be looking for something like isp0 however from what I have been reading the board is not well supported by FreeBSD which is what FreeNAS is based on so it may not work at all. https://forums.freebsd.org/threads/55029/
